The battle grew increasingly fierce, finally alerting Lian Xing.

Fortunately, Lian Xing arrived in time to restrain Yao Yue; otherwise, had Yao Yue stubbornly persisted, she would have been beaten by the diary copy until she spat blood.

After "teaching" Yao Yue a lesson, the diary copy automatically flew into Yao Yue's hands.

Yao Yue tried to throw it away, but could not.

Clearly, the diary copy conveyed one message: What I give you, you must accept!

This nearly drove Yao Yue to death with rage.

Fortunately, with Lian Xing persuading her beside her, she had no choice but to accept this fact.

Then, upon opening the diary copy and seeing the various secrets recorded within, she was stunned.

Yao Yue suddenly felt that having such a thing might not be so bad.

Yet just then, the diary copy updated its title page.

[Character: Yao Yue]

[Appearance: 10]

[Affinity: 4]

Seeing the information above, Yao Yue's temper exploded on the spot!

She was not surprised by the perfect score for appearance; if even she could not achieve it, then there would be something wrong with the diary copy.

What angered Yao Yue was that her affinity score was only four!

Dislike!

You dislike me yet forcibly shove the diary copy into my hands; are you sick?!

Of course, deep down, Yao Yue knew this likely had nothing to do with Jiang Sishui, since he did not even know of the diary copy's existence.

As for whether Jiang Sishui was pretending to be ignorant?

That possibility could not be ruled out, but the probability was low.

Because putting herself in his shoes, Yao Yue felt that if it were her, knowing others could read the diary, she would absolutely not expose so much information.

To say nothing of other things; if Jiang Sishui knew they possessed the diary copy, would he so blatantly display his philandering nature?

However, speaking frankly, the low affinity score was merely a secondary factor in Yao Yue's anger.

After all, she was a proud woman and did not care overly much about others' opinions of her.

The fundamental reason for her such intense anger was Lian Xing!

Lian Xing also possessed a diary copy.

And what was written on that title page was unmistakably—

[Character: Lian Xing]

[Appearance: 10]

[Affinity: 8]

The same high appearance score, yet her own "affinity" was only half of Lian Xing's!

Just barely scraping past the passing line!

How could Yao Yue endure this?

Women all enjoy comparing themselves to others, and Yao Yue was no exception, even if some comparisons were truly ridiculous.

But losing to her own younger sister still made Yao Yue extremely displeased.

006. The Women's Reward, Truth Water

Lian Xing and Yao Yue had grown up together; no one knows a sister better than her younger sibling, so Lian Xing understood exactly what Yao Yue was thinking.

Seeing Yao Yue gnashing her teeth in helplessness, Lian Xing suddenly felt a sense of satisfaction in her heart.

From childhood until now, this older sister of hers had been overwhelmingly domineering, always needing to surpass her in everything, possessing an intense desire for control that tolerated not the slightest disobedience from anyone.

Including herself, this younger sister.

Furthermore, Yao Yue also possessed an extremely strong sense of possessiveness.

Regarding anything good, if her younger sister had it, she must have it too; if she did not have it, then her younger sister was not allowed to have it either!

Only after she obtained it could her younger sister have it!

It was exactly that unreasonable and tyrannical.

Therefore, having lived for so long under Yao Yue's oppressive rule, Lian Xing inevitably harbored some resentment in her heart.

It was only because of that incident from their childhood that Yao Yue had left a shadow in her heart, making her never dare to resist.

Now, seeing someone able to make Yao Yue suffer a setback, and realizing that her status in that person's heart was even higher than her sister's, Lian Xing instantly felt immensely gratified.

Consequently, she also developed considerable goodwill toward Jiang Sishui.

"He likes me... he likes me?"

Thinking of the affinity rating, Lian Xing suddenly felt a strange sense of novelty in her heart.

There was a hint of secret joy, and a touch of pride.

To think that, having grown up until now, no man had ever expressed love to her.

Of course, this was also related to her rarely leaving the Shifted Flower Palace for years.

Besides, given her title as the Second Palace Master of the Shifted Flower Palace, even if ordinary men had the intention, they would lack the courage!

"Pity he is such a philanderer."

Lian Xing secretly sighed; seeing that Yao Yue had already vented her anger, she immediately stepped forward.

She did not mention the matter of affinity, lest Yao Yue lose face, but instead changed the subject: "Sister, do you truly believe this world is an illusion and fabrication? Could it be that we are all fake?"

Yao Yue slightly calmed her anger and said coldly, "Fake? If we are fake, then he himself is also fake!"

Yao Yue did not care about the so-called truth of the world; she only needed to know that she was currently a living, breathing person, and that was enough.

Besides, even if they are false, what can she do about it?

Lian Xing naturally knew this as well; she had only asked to divert Yao Yue's attention.

"Then what of the martial arts and treasures recorded here?" Lian Xing asked Yao Yue with some hesitation.

Yao Yue frowned, then said, "Send the maids to search Mount Mount Mount Emei and Mount Wuliang Mountain; the others are too far, so let them be."

Although the Flower Transfer Palace possessed two sect-suppressing martial arts—"Bright Jade Technique" and "Flower Transfer Jade Reception"—both divine skills of the current age that would make one a Grandmaster upon mastery.

Yet Yao Yue knew clearly in her heart that these two divine skills paled in comparison to the Sacred Canon and the Heavenly Art!

Yao Yue was proud, but no fool; how could something constantly dwelt upon by the diary's owner be an ordinary object?

At the very least, it must be a divine skill!

If she were fortunate enough to obtain the Sacred Canon or even the Heavenly Art, she might advance further, breaking through the Grandmaster realm to become a Heavenly Human!

Or even reach higher levels!

How could she remain indifferent to this?

"It is a pity that the only treasure whose location is explicitly stated is the Six Ren Divine Dice held by Jiang Jiang Biehe. By the time we ascertain this person's identity and go there, someone else will likely have gotten there first," Lian Xing sighed with regret.

Yao Yue's expression remained unchanged as she said coldly, "That Six Ren Divine Dice has appeared many times in the Wu Lin, yet no one has ever unlocked its secrets; so what if one obtains it? Unless that person wrote it down in the diary."

Lian Xing reflected and agreed.

After a moment of silence, Lian Xing suddenly asked, "Sister, do you think the worlds of sword immortals, profound fantasy, and primordial chaos described in the diary are real?"

When she first saw the diary's description of those three high-grade worlds, Lian Xing was completely stunned.

Immortality was already an unimaginable luxury for them, while the worlds of profound fantasy and primordial chaos exceeded their imagination entirely.

Could a mere insignificant blade of grass slash through the sun, moon, and stars?

Could a single thought cause the birth and destruction of ten thousand worlds?

What kind of joke was this!

Was she certain this wasn't just telling mythical stories?

If not for the diary copy being so miraculous, Lian Xing would never have believed a single word of it.

But if all this were true, what sort of spectacle would such a world be?

A sense of longing spontaneously arose in Lian Xing's heart.

Yao Yue fell silent as well; evidently, her inner heart was equally unsettled.

However, this was a question she clearly could not answer, and after a long pause, she spoke: "You go to Mount Mount Emei; I will go to Mount Wuliang."

With that, Yao Yue turned and left the palace, swift and decisive.

"Let me accompany Sister to Mount Wuliang Mountain!" Lian Xing said with some concern.
